Pakistanโs batting coach, Mohammad Yousuf, has decided to travel with the team for their white-ball series in New Zealand after initially pulling out due to his daughterโs health issues.
Yesterday, reports suggested that Yousuf had withdrawn from the tour, leaving the team without a batting coach. However, after receiving positive news about his daughterโs recovery, he reversed his decision and confirmed his availability.
“Touring with the Pakistan cricket team is a national duty, and I am going to discharge it,” Yousuf stated.
This decision comes as a relief for Pakistanโs struggling batting lineup, which desperately needs guidance ahead of a challenging series against the Black Caps.

Pakistan’s Tour of New Zealand: A Tough Test Awaits
Pakistanโs squad departed for New Zealand on Wednesday, gearing up for an intense series. The tour includes five T20Is and three ODIs, with matches spread across multiple cities.
Hereโs a look at the T20I schedule:
๐ March 16 โ 1st T20I (Christchurch)
๐ March 18 โ 2nd T20I (Dunedin)
๐ March 21 โ 3rd T20I (Auckland)
๐ March 23 โ 4th T20I (Mount Maunganui)
๐ March 26 โ 5th T20I (Wellington)
Once the T20I series wraps up, the focus will shift to the ODIs.
๐ March 29 โ 1st ODI (Napier)
๐ April 2 โ 2nd ODI (Hamilton)
๐ April 5 โ 3rd ODI (Mount Maunganui)
